Gunmen Abduct Plateau Lawmaker from Home

JOS — Gunmen have reportedly abducted Hon. Laven Denty, a member of the Plateau State House of Assembly representing Pankshin South Constituency, from his home in the Dong area of Jos North Local Government Area.

The incident adds to Plateau State’s ongoing battle with insecurity. DAILY POST recalls that last week, gunmen also stormed Dong community, abducting a serving National Youth Service Corps (NYSC) member and a University of Jos student. The attackers reportedly broke into Solomon Dansura’s residence around 10 p.m., taking his two young guests in the process.

As of the time of filing this report, there has been no official response from state authorities or confirmation from the Plateau State Police Command.

The growing wave of kidnappings in the region continues to raise concerns over security measures in Plateau State.
